printf函数输出文字,用printf输出一句中文
- 前端设计
- 2023-08-28
- 65
本篇文章给大家谈谈printf函数输出文字,以及用printf输出一句中文对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所...
本篇文章给大家谈谈printf函数输出文字,以及用printf输出一句中文对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
c语言print怎么用
在C语言中,你可以使用printf函数来打印输出文本或变量的值。以下是使用printf函数的一些示例:
打印文本:
printf("Hello,World!");//输出:Hello,World!
打印变量的值:
intnum=10;
printf("Thevalueofnumis%d",num);//输出:Thevalueofnumis10
打印多个变量的值:
inta=5;
intb=7;
printf("Thevaluesare%dand%d",a,b);//输出:Thevaluesare5and7
格式化输出:
floatpi=3.14159;
printf("Thevalueofpiis%.2f",pi);//输出:Thevalueofpiis3.14
在上述示例中,%d和%f是格式化占位符,用于指定变量的类型和输出格式。例如,%d用于整数,%f用于浮点数。
c语言输出要求文字说明
1
对于初学者来说,初期的C语言都是针对控制台来说的,说以我们今天在控制台上输出一行字;首先第一步,你打开软件,第一行代码要写头文在这个头文件里包含了我们要调用的函数。
2
第二行就是main函数了,他是程序执行的入口,势必不可少的;
3
第三部,Main函数写完之后,一点还要再下面加大括号,漏加大括号是初学者经常犯的问题。
4
写完大括号,就开始调用函数了我们调用prin他·的功能就是在屏幕上输出一行字;
5
要注意printf函数的格式,里面有双引号;外面有分号。
6
加上return0;就结束了,点击编译,在运行们就可以在控制台上使出你想输出的字了。
c语言printf的输出格式
printf的格式控制的完整格式:
%-0m.nl或h格式字符
下面对组成格式说明的各项加以说明:
①%:表示格式说明的起始符号,不可缺少。
②-:有-表示左对齐输出,如省略表示右对齐输出。
③0:有0表示指定空位填0,如省略表示指定空位不填。
④m.n:m指域宽,即对应的输出项在输出设备上所占的字符数。N指精度。用于说明输出的实型数的小数位数。为指定n时,隐含的精度为n=6位。
⑤l或h:l对整型指long型,对实型指double型。h用于将整型的格式字符修正为short型。
c语言输出时如何显示文字描述
'直接有printf函数输出文字字符串就可以了
printf中文乱码是怎么回事
在使用printf函数输出中文字符时,可能会出现中文乱码的情况。这是由于printf函数默认使用的编码方式是ASCII码,而中文字符并不属于ASCII码字符集,因此在输出中文字符时会出现乱码。
为了解决中文乱码的问题,可以在程序中设置正确的编码方式,例如UTF-8编码。具体的做法是,在程序开头添加如下代码:
```
#include<locale.h>
setlocale(LC_ALL,"en_US.UTF-8");
```
其中,"en_US.UTF-8"表示使用美国英语的UTF-8编码方式。如果需要使用其他语言的编码方式,可以根据实际情况进行修改。
另外,在输出中文字符时,还可以使用Unicode编码方式,例如UTF-16或UTF-32。在使用printf函数输出中文字符时,可以使用Unicode转义序列来表示中文字符,例如:
```
printf("\u4e2d\u6587");//输出中文字符“你好”
```
printf(“”)是什么意思c语言中
1,printf()函数是格式化输出函数,一般用于向标准输出设备按规定格式输出信息。
2,printf()函数的调用格式为:printf("<格式化字符串>",<参量表>)。
3,格式输出,它是c语言中产生格式化输出的函数(在stdio.h中定义)。用于向终端(显示器、控制台等)输出字符。格式控制由要输出的文字和数据格式说明组成。要输出的的文字除了可以使用字母、数字、空格和一些数字符号以外,还可以使用一些转义字符表示特殊的含义。
4,作用:在c语言中产生格式化输出的函数(定义在stdio.h中),其向终端(显示器、控制台等)输出字符。
文章分享结束,printf函数输出文字和用printf输出一句中文的答案你都知道了吗?欢迎再次光临本站哦!
本文链接:http://xinin56.com/qianduan/11285.html